Urban Style Developments Coming To College Station
texan replied to citykid09's topic in Bryan-College Station
This project, now called Aspire A&M, has secured construction financing. Hopefully some movement starts soon. I'll be keeping an eye out for it on my next trip through College Station. https://www.multihousingnews.com/harrison-street-jv-lands-loan-for-texas-student-housing/ -

PNC Plaza At 2200 Post Oak Blvd. & Mixed-Use At 2120 Post Oak Blvd.
ChannelTwoNews replied to lockmat's topic in Going Up!
McCarthy Building Cos. to leave Greenway Plaza for Galleria area - Houston Business Journal (bizjournals.com) "St. Louis-based McCarthy Building Cos. is preparing to leave its current office at 3800 Buffalo Speedway after signing a lease for 38,230 square feet of office space at 2200 Post Oak near The Galleria mall. McCarthy, which is building local projects such as the Ismaili Center in the United States, has officed at 3800 Buffalo Speedway since 2016."- 645 replies
